Proposed initial set of quality metrics for promotion into Apps. Unlike in maemo.org Extras, a guided form will be provided.
| Question | Possible answers | Requirement | |||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Days in quarantine? | System | >= 10 | |||
| Screenshot in OBS. if user-facing? | System | n/a | |||
| Should be in Apps? | Yes | No | y - n > 10 | Mandatory | |
| Appropriate icon, if user-installable? | Yes | No | Don't know | y - n > 3 | Optional |
| Appropriate description? | Yes | No | Don't know | ||
| Impacts power/performance in unexpected way? | Yes | No | Don't know | y - n > 2 | |
| Obvious license/copyright issues? | Yes | No | Don't know | ||
| Uninstall cleanly? | Yes | No | Don't know | ||
Some packages will be urgent bug fixes in response to an external API change or critcial bug. In addition to a package owner (or repository master) being able to pull a package on-demand; the promotion capability to -testing should have a Critical bug-fix box (if, and only if, the package already exists in Apps). This will:
| Question | Possible answers | Requirement | |||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Introduces new functionality? | Yes | No | n - y > 5 | Mandatory | |
Regular reporting will be done over the use of the critical fix flag. If testers or packagers are found to be abusing it, they will be banned from further testing and/or use of the flag for a period (to be determined).
